What is Live Resin? Live resin is a type of cannabis concentrate that is made using fresh, frozen cannabis plants. The plants are harvested and immediately frozen to preserve the terpenes and cannabinoids. The frozen plants are then extracted using a solvent, typically butane or propane, which is then evaporated to leave behind a sticky, resinous substance. Live resin is known for its high terpene content, which gives it a strong and flavorful aroma and taste. How to Identify Good Quality Live Resin? What is Shatter? Shatter is a type of cannabis concentrate that is known for its glass-like appearance and high potency. It is a form of butane hash oil (BHO) extract, which is made by extracting the cannabinoids and terpenes from cannabis plant material using butane as a solvent. The resulting extract is then purged of residual solvents to create a concentrated form of cannabis that is typically amber or translucent and has a brittle, shatter-like texture at room temperature. Shatter is known for its high levels of THC (tetrahydrocannabinol), the psychoactive compound found in cannabis, which can range from 70% to even upwards of 90% or more in some cases, making it one of the most potent forms of cannabis available. It also contains other cannabinoids and terpenes that contribute to its unique flavor profile and effects. What is Live resin? Live resin is a type of cannabis concentrate that is known for its high potency and rich flavor profile. It is made from fresh, flash-frozen cannabis plants that have been harvested before drying and curing, preserving the plant's terpene and cannabinoid content. Live resin extraction typically involves using solvents, such as butane or propane, to separate the cannabinoids and terpenes from the plant material, resulting in a highly concentrated and flavorful product. One of the key differences between live resin and other cannabis concentrates is the use of fresh, frozen plant material instead of dried and cured cannabis. This allows for the preservation of the volatile terpenes, which are responsible for the distinct aroma and flavor of cannabis strains. Live resin is often praised for its robust and intense flavors, as well as its high potency, which can exceed that of other concentrates.
